This holiday season, law enforcement is lasering in on drunk drivers.

Last year in Oklahoma, more than 170 people died in crashes involving alcohol. Four people lost their lives over the Christmas holiday in alcohol- and drug-related crashes.

So far in 2016, Oklahoma City police investigators have worked 76 fatality accidents. With holiday season in full swing, departments are reminding everyone to drive safe, buckle up, don’t drive impaired or distracted, and obey the rules of the road.

Even better, AAA Oklahoma's Tipsy Tow service is available for a free ride home, no questions asked. It's free to everyone. They'll drive you, your vehicle, and a second passenger to only your home within a 15 mile radius of the pickup point.

The program is active now and ends on January 2 at 4 a.m. It is available in metro area.
